When dining in Chulabhorn, embracing local customs enhances the experience. Meals are typically communal, with dishes shared among diners.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for excellent service, with a small amount (around 10%) being customary in more formal settings. It's polite to use your fork and spoon, with the spoon being the primary utensil for eating. Be mindful of spice levels; if you prefer milder food, politely request "mai phet" (not spicy). Understanding these nuances will ensure a more enjoyable and respectful dining experience.

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Chulabhorn

Navigating the cultural landscape of Chulabhorn requires an awareness of local customs that can differ significantly from Western norms, ensuring a respectful and harmonious visit. The Thai concept of "sanuk" (fun) permeates daily life, encouraging a lighthearted approach, but it's important to remember that respect for elders and authority figures is paramount. Public displays of affection are generally frowned upon, and maintaining a calm demeanour, even in frustrating situations, is highly valued. Understanding these subtle social cues will greatly enhance your interactions with locals.

When visiting temples or religious sites in Chulabhorn, dress codes are strictly enforced; shoulders and knees must be covered, and shoes should be removed before entering sacred spaces. It is considered disrespectful to point your feet at Buddha images or monks. When interacting with monks, women should avoid direct physical contact. Photography is usually permitted, but always check for signs or ask permission. In general, maintaining a polite and humble attitude, using the "wai" (a slight bow with palms pressed together) as a greeting, will be well-received by the local community.

The best time to visit Chulabhorn generally aligns with Thailand's dry season, which typically runs from November to February. During these months, the weather is cooler and less humid, making it ideal for outdoor exploration and sightseeing. This period also coincides with peak tourist season for Thailand, meaning accommodation prices might be slightly higher, and popular spots could be more crowded. For travellers from the US and Europe, this timing often aligns with their winter holidays, while Indian travellers might find the shoulder seasons (March-May or September-October) offer a good balance of pleasant weather and fewer crowds.

Before embarking on your journey to Chulabhorn, a few pre-departure preparations will ensure a smooth trip. The local currency is the Thai Baht (THB), and while major credit cards are accepted in larger establishments, carrying some cash for markets and smaller vendors is essential. You can exchange currency at the airport or in Chulabhorn. Pur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ival is highly recommended for easy communication and data access. Essential apps to download include Google Maps for navigation, a translation app, and the Grab app for transportation. Ensure your passport has at least six months of validity remaining.

Visa Information

For Philippine passport holders planning a trip to Thailand to visit Chulabhorn, the visa requirements are generally straightforward, offering visa-free entry for tourism purposes. Typically, Filipino citizens are permitted to enter Thailand for a stay of up to 30 days without a visa when arriving by air, and potentially longer if arriving by land or sea, though specific durations can vary and should be confirmed. It is crucial to ensure your Philippine passport has at least six months of validity beyond your intended stay and that you possess a confirmed onward or return ticket.

When entering Thailand for tourism, immigration officials may request proof of sufficient funds to cover your stay, although this is not always strictly checked for short tourist visits. While a visa is not required for short stays, it is always prudent to check the latest regulations with the Royal Thai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ines, as policies can change.
